Materialistic Consumers Who Need To Signal Their Status: Examination of Antecedents and Consequences of Consumers’ Luxury Brands Engagement on Social Media
Abstract:The purpose of this research is to understand the key drivers and outcomes of consumer brand engagement (CBE) with luxury brands on social media. Specifically, this study aims to examine the mediating effect of CBE between antecedents (materialism, need for status signaling) and brand outcomes (brand attitude and brand usage intention) when consumer involvement (CI) is controlled.
